Transaction 39a39b959b557eaddee0acf01f1a77a0acbe8971589bc15d1c75da5eaaf4779f
1 Input
1 Output
-
39a39b959b557eaddee0acf01f1a77a0acbe8971589bc15d1c75da5eaaf4779f:0
- value
- 3067598
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 007d4e75fd87cf5d632314bcc1b3dff03b742dad OP_EQUALVERIFY OP_CHECKSIG
- address
- 113b7Sx6cviAoQEQMUGbZhtFuMJfbKFUx3